Disability Discrimination Act 1995
This UK Parliamentary Act of 1995 makes it unlawful to discriminate against people in respect of their disabilities in relation to employment, the provision of goods and services. education and transport. It is a Civil Rights Law.
The British Government also set up the Disability Rights Commission to provide support for the act.
It is still acceptable for employees to have reasonable medical criteria for employment, and to expect adequate performance from all employees once any reasonable adjustments have been made.
The core concepts in the Disability Discrimination Act 1995 are preventing:-
> Less favourable treatment for a reason related to a disabled person's disability
> Failure to make a reasonable adjustment
The effects of this act, as well as possible consequences, can be far reaching for some employers as well as employees.
It is therefore vital that all reasonable steps are taken to comply with the legislation and requirements.
